svelte-reviews-project Svelte Themes

Svelte Reviews Project

Simple app to study Svelte. It is a the frontend of service rating site.

Yungas Front-end Challenge

O objetivo deste desafio é avaliar a sua maneira de pensar e resolver os problemas propostos.

A forma como você resolverá este desafio é importante para entendermos seus padrões de qualidade, organização, performance, etc. No final, lhe daremos retorno sobre os pontos que achamos positivos e negativos.

A Yungas utiliza Svelte para seu front-end. Familiaridade com Svelte não é um requerimento, mas um diferencial. Se você teve experiência com outros frameworks (React, Vue, Angular) também será válido.

O Desafio

A Yungas é uma plataforma para redes de franquias com diversos módulos. A ideia desse desafio é simular, de maneira simplificada, o processo de desenvolvimento de um módulo da plataforma: o módulo de Treinamento.

O módulo de Treinamento é utilizado pelos clientes da Yungas para facilitar a capacitação de colaboradores e franqueados de suas redes, melhorando a produtividade dos colaboradores e o desempenho das franquias.

Neste repositório você vai encontrar mockups do módulo de Treinamento, juntamente com um arquivo em Markdown (USER-STORIES.md) descrevendo algumas das ações que usuários que solicitaram a feature querem executar nesse módulo.

Sua tarefa é implementar as ações do módulo seguindo a linha estética dos mockups. Sinta-se livre para tomar suas próprias decisões de UI/UX e preencher "gaps" nos mockups. Suas decisões de UI/UX e sua capacidade de interpretação dos mockups serão utilizadas como critério de avaliação.

Mockup

As Regras

  • Implementar em algum framework de front-end, de preferência o Svelte.
  • Disponibilizar o resultado em repositório público (não importa a plataforma).

Os Critérios

  • Organização do projeto de acordo com responsabilidades.
  • Organização e reutilização do código via componentização.
  • Interpretação das intenções estéticas do mockup, capacidade de preencher os "gaps".

Extras

  • Se fizer em Svelte, top, gostamos de Svelte :^)
  • Responsividade & mobile first.
  • Utilizar TailwindCSS.
  • Presença e qualidade de testes.
  • Clean architecture.
  • Explicações (pode ser no README) de como seria o deploy deste app.
  • Deploy onde desejar, coloque o link no readme.

Obs.: Em relação aos extras, não é "tudo ou nada", faça o que conseguir!

Top categories

svelte logo

Need a Svelte website built?

Hire a professional Svelte developer today.
Loading Svelte Themes